Latest election result

Candidate result data from the Parliament Members API.

Lab Gain Bangor Aberconwy Turnout 41,660
Candidate Party Votes Share
Claire Hughes Lab Labour 14,008 33.6 %
Catrin Wager PC Plaid Cymru 9,112 21.9 %
Robin Millar Con Conservative 9,036 21.7 %
John Clark RUK Reform UK 6,091 14.6 %
Rachael Roberts LD Liberal Democrat 1,524 3.7 %
Petra Haig Green Green Party 1,361 3.3 %
Kathrine Jones Socialist Labour Party 424 1.0 %
Steve Marshall Climate Party 104 0.2 %

Source: UK Parliament Members API

Registered interests

3. Gifts, benefits and hospitality from UK sources (1)

Name of donor: The UK Interactive Entertainment Association Limited Address of donor: Lower Ground Floor, Black Bull Yard, 18a, 24-28 Hatton Wall, London EC1N 8JH Amount of donation or nature and value if donation in kind: Ticket to the Bafta Games Awards, value £700 Date received: 8 April 2025 Date accepted: 8 April 2025 Donor status: company, registration 02420400 (Registered 7 May 2025)
